Why This Vegetable Soup is a Stomach-Friendly Delight
Each ingredient in this vegetable soup has been thoughtfully chosen for its health benefits. Here’s why this soup can be your go-to comfort food for better digestion and overall health:
- Onion: Known for its anti-inflammatory properties, onions are packed with fiber and prebiotics, which promote healthy digestion. They help to detoxify the body and regulate blood sugar levels, making them a great addition to this soup.
- Olive Oil: This healthy fat source is packed with antioxidants that help reduce inflammation in the stomach lining and aid in digestion. Olive oil is also known to have a protective effect on the stomach, which is why it’s often recommended for people with gastric problems.
- Leeks: Closely related to onions and garlic, leeks contain compounds that support digestive health. They are high in fiber, which helps keep your digestive tract moving and promotes healthy gut flora.
- Celery: This vegetable has high water content and is known for its ability to help reduce bloating and gas. Celery is also rich in antioxidants that combat free radicals and protect your stomach lining from damage.
- Carrots: Rich in beta-carotene and fiber, carrots help support the digestive system and maintain gut health. Their high antioxidant content helps reduce inflammation, particularly in the stomach and intestines.
- Red Pepper: Full of vitamin C, red bell peppers help boost your immune system and reduce oxidative stress in your digestive tract. They also help soothe inflammation and promote healing in your stomach lining.
- Zucchini: This low-calorie vegetable is an excellent source of hydration and fiber, which helps improve bowel movement and digestive health. Zucchini also has anti-inflammatory properties that help calm your stomach.
- Potatoes: Rich in potassium and easily digestible starch, potatoes are gentle on the stomach. They help replenish electrolytes and support your digestive system.
- Garlic: Garlic is well-known for its antimicrobial properties, which help balance the gut flora. It also stimulates the production of digestive juices, aiding in smoother digestion.
- Chili Pepper: (Optional for spice) Chili peppers are known for their metabolism-boosting properties. They contain capsaicin, which can help improve digestion and reduce bloating. However, be mindful of the quantity, as too much spice can sometimes irritate the stomach.
The Health Benefits of This Vegetable Soup
This soup goes beyond its delicious taste—it offers several health benefits that make it a must-have in your diet. Here’s why this vegetable soup should become a staple in your kitchen:
- Supports Digestive Health: The combination of high-fiber vegetables helps regulate bowel movements, prevent constipation, and maintain overall digestive health. Each ingredient plays a role in ensuring a healthy gut.
- Reduces Inflammation: Chronic inflammation can affect your digestive system and lead to conditions like irritable bowel syndrome (IBS). The anti-inflammatory properties of vegetables like garlic, onions, and celery can help reduce this inflammation, promoting a healthier stomach lining.
- Boosts Immunity: With ingredients like garlic, red pepper, and carrots, this soup helps strengthen your immune system. These ingredients are packed with vitamins and antioxidants that protect your body against harmful pathogens, promoting a healthy digestive system.
- Helps with Weight Management: Low in calories but packed with nutrients, this soup is great for those looking to maintain a healthy weight. The high fiber content will keep you feeling fuller for longer, preventing overeating.
- Hydrating: Many of the vegetables in this soup have high water content, such as zucchini and celery, which help keep you hydrated while nourishing your body. Proper hydration is crucial for smooth digestion and optimal health.
- Natural Detox: The fiber and antioxidants in this soup help detoxify your body by promoting healthy bowel movements and flushing out toxins. It can also support liver and kidney health, which further aids in digestion.
